当TPWallet中某个资产不显示时,问题往往不是单点故障,而是链层、代币标准、RPC/Indexer、前端缓存与权限的交互结果。本指南以技术视角分析原因、详述排查流程,并延展到先进技术如何从根本上减少此类问题。 主要成因与排查流程(逐步执行) 1) 链与网络:确认当前网络(如ETH、BSC、Polygon)是否正确,切换或添加自定义RPC以避免节点不同步导致余额/事件缺失。 2) 自定义代币添加:通过合约地址、decimals、symbol手动添加;若代币使用非标准接口(ERC777、ERC1155、非ERC20映射)需特殊处理。 3) 事件索引与RPC:钱包依赖日志过滤和索引器(TheGraph、自建Indexer)构建资产列表,若Indexer落后或RPC返回不完整,前端无法识别转账事件。 4) 代币增发与映射问题:代币增发/燃烧、代币合约更换或迁移会导致旧资产记录“消失”——需在区块浏览器确认合约事件与快照。 5) 客户端因素:缓存、权限、后台限制或旧版本SDhttps:

//www.lqyun8.com ,K可能导致UI不刷新,建议清缓存、更新或重装并重新导入助记词进行对照验证。 6) 安全与权限:某些代币在合约层需要特定Approve或白名单,未完成的跨链

桥接会让资产处于桥端而非钱包内。 先进科技前沿与缓解路径: 1) 轻客户端与本地索引:通过运行轻量化SPV或轻索引器把链数据本地化,降低对远程RPC的依赖。 2) 跨链消息聚合:采用可靠消息层(IBC、CCIP样式)与统一资产注册表减少链间映射错误。 3) Account Abstraction与Gas Sponsor:通过Paymaster和meta-transactions实现Gasless显示与自动同步。 Gas管理实务:采用EIP-1559费估计、批量交易、Gas预付或由DApp侧兜底的Gas sponsorship来避免因手续费不足导致状态中断。 未来预测与数字支付创新:钱包将向“可验证可见”演进——设备端可查证的交易索引、统一资产目录、可编程支付通道、对接法币和CBDC的即时结算机制,将把“看不见”的资产概率降至最低。 结论:排查应从链选择、合约标准、事件索引、客户端缓存与权限五层并行着手;长远来看,轻客户端、跨链消息层与资产注册表是根治之道。执行本手册的步骤通常能在用户侧快速恢复可见性,同时为产品设计提供防护性改进方向。
作者:林亦舟发布时间:2025-10-10 04:21:11